> Deprecate DefaultEndpoint constructors that create partially constructed 
> endpoints

> There are 2 DefaultEndpoint constructors that are not necessary, are not 
> really used (and as the doc says they should not be used anyway) that I 
> intend to remove. One issue is that during endpoint construction because the 
> component and context are set later services from the context such as type 
> converters are not yet available which may lead to errors (or unnecessarily 
> complicated code).
>     protected DefaultEndpoint(String, CamelContext);
>     protected DefaultEndpoint(String);
> possibly
>     protected DefaultEndpoint();
> There are also a number of components defining constructors that just mimic 
> those that are not necessary and not used either. Those can be removed now.
